There are so many things to do nearby! Here are some ideas:
Time on the water: • Southwind Marina is 100 yards away; boaters are welcome. • Paddleboarding, jet skiing, sailing and deep-sea fishing at Rock Bottom Charters, • • Blue Dolphin Cruises and Big Lagoon Jet Ski rental (1 mi). • Big Lagoon State Park (1 mi) and famous Johnson’s Beach (with its sugar-white sand directly on the Gulf of Mexico) is a quick 2 miles away. • Gulf Islands National Seashore Park (2 mi) is a beautiful wild stretch of sand referred to as a ‘treasure’ among the more developed beaches in the area, and offers hiking, biking trails, kayaking, snorkeling, wild-watching and Ranger-led tours.
Eating and drinking: • Local breweries include Gary’s Brewery and Biergarten on Gulf Beach Highway and Pensacola Bay Brewery. • Blue Bayou Coffee Company on Gulf Beach Highway • Jaco’s, an upscale fine dining facility, is just down the road. • For the gourmet, a visit to Joe Paddy’s Seafood reveals the freshest seafood selections arriving daily on its shrimp boat fleet. • Famous Flora-Bama (7 mi) hosts weekly live concerts on the beach, is a popular hot spot and dance venue.
Sporting: • Golfing opportunities can be found at Lost Key Golf Club (3 mi) and Perdido Bay Golf Club (2 mi). • Public tennis courts are available all around Pensacola, and private coaching is available at Roger Scott Tennis Center. • Perdido Key Children’s Park is within walking distance of our home. • AA Pensacola Wahoos minor league baseball (Miami Marlins farm team) is a popular family attraction.
Arts and Culture: • The world famous National Naval Aviation Museum (at1 mi) is an absolute must-see attraction. The Pensacola Lighthouse is also on base and a popular spot. • Downtown historic Seville Square is listed on the National Register of Historic Sites and features a gazebo for local free concerts and festivals. • T. T. Wentworth Museum, located in Plaza Ferdinand VII, is part of the historic Pensacola Village Museum complex.
Local excursions: • The Pensacola Beach Boardwalk is a 15 mile drive and Santa Rosa Island is a popular day trip. • Orange Beach, Alabama is a 15 mile drive and popular excursion for beaching on the Gulf, dining and shopping. • New Orleans is a 3 hour drive and easy overnight trip.
